As diffuse as it is going to start, as precise may it become within the process. This new series, let me call it IME, deals with one particular structure that keeps following me: the symmetry of Information, Matter, and Energy. I will start to elaborate on that.

With “symmetry”, I mean something like equivalence, a “distinction without a difference” (cf. Wilczek), the same coin or elephant from different sides.

The idea of equivalence of Matter and Energy is at the core of both contemporary mainstream directions in physics, quantum mechanics (in the form of the wave/particle dualism or de Broglie’s E=h*nu) and relativity (in the very form of Einstein’s E=m*c^2). The idea of adding the dimension of Information to this equivalence first encountered me in the form of the prediction of Information’s mass by Vopson (just in 2019, estimating 2.5 × 10^-22 g for a TB in non-relativistic terms). Maletto’s physical description of classical and quantum Information in physical terms employing the power of counterfactuals is just another beautiful approach for what is basically known to a variety of spiritual theories around the globe for ages. And even though I love the physical description (interestingly, what both, Vopson’s and Maletto’s approach, have in common is the non-relativity of their descriptions, and with information, entropy becomes a different role – let’s catch up on that later), let me rather dwell about the implications of the IME symmetry.
